549 girls have been named Latresa since 1956, though it isn't currently a top-ranked name.
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Latresa has been recorded 549 times among girls since 1956, though it is not among the currently most-used girls names, with its heaviest use in the 1970s. 44% of everyone ever named Latresa was born in this single decade.
39 babies were named Latresa in 1974 - its busiest year on record.
Latresa's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Divide Latresa's SSA record in two at 1975 and the more recent half accounts for 51%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 49%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 1958,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1974 peak of 39,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Latresa by decade
Total births in each ten-year window, peak vs trough at a glance
1970s was Latresa's strongest decade.
239 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 44% of all-time use.
